Effect of Chinese herbal compound QHF on human Huh7 hepatoma cell proliferation and invasion, and expression of surface markers of cancer stem cells

摘要: 目的:研究中药QHF复方对人肝癌Huh7细胞生长、凋亡和侵袭能力的作用,并初步研究其对肿瘤干细胞表面标志物表达的影响。方法:体外培养人肝癌Huh7细胞,MTT法检测QHF复方对细胞增殖的影响;流式细胞术检测QHF复方对Huh7细胞周期及凋亡的影响;Transwell实验检测QHF复方对Huh7细胞侵袭能力的影响;流式细胞仪检测QHF复方作用后Huh7细胞肿瘤干细胞表面标志物CD133和CD44的表达情况。结果:与溶剂对照组比较,QHF复方能够抑制Huh7细胞增殖,并且这种抑制作用具有剂量和时间依赖性(P均 < 0.05);QHF复方能诱导细胞凋亡,使其生长周期阻滞在S期;QHF复方能够降低Huh7细胞的侵袭能力(P < 0.05);并能够下调肿瘤干细胞表面标记物CD133和CD44的表达(P < 0.05)。结论:中药QHF复方能够抑制Huh7细胞的生长、侵袭,这种抑制作用可能与肿瘤干细胞表面标记物CD133和CD44表达的下调有关。

Abstract: OBJECTIVE: To explore the influence of Chinese herbal compound QHF on human Huh7 hepatoma cell proliferation,apoptosis and invasion and expression of surface markers of cancer stem cells. METHODS: Human Huh7 hepatoma cells were cultured in vitro. Cell proliferation inhibition rate was detected by MTT assay;cell cycle,apoptosis and cell surface marker CD133 and CD44 expression were detected by Flow cytometry;transwell experiment was used to observe cell invasion. RESULTS: QHF inhibited the proliferation of Huh7 cells,and there was a dose-dependent inhibitory effect. In addition,QHF promoted apoptosis and significantly increased cell proportion in S phase of the cell cycle. QHF lowered expression of tumor stem cell surface markers:CD133 and CD44. CONCLUSION: QHF was able to inhibit human Huh7 hepatoma cell proliferation and migration in vitro,the inhibition was related to the reduced expression of tumor stem cell surface markers:CD133 and CD44.
